AC Milan sign Estupinan from Brighton on long-term contract

July 25, 2025

Ecuadorian defender Pervis Estupinan has completed a move to AC Milan from Brighton & Hove Albion in a transfer worth £17 million, including bonuses. The 27-year-old has signed a contract that will keep him at the San Siro until 2030. Estupinan had been a regular figure at Brighton since arriving from Villarreal in 2022. During […]

Provedel Signs Long-Term Deal with Lazio

February 24, 2024

Lazio has officially announced the extension of goalkeeper Ivan Provedel’s contract with the club, now set to run until the summer of 2027. The 29-year-old goalkeeper joined the Stadio Olimpico from Spezia in the summer of 2022 and has since showcased remarkable performances for the Biancocelesti.
